Your problem sounds like a TrueType fonts related one. This is not
necessarily related to the Linux or NT server: I have the same problem
when printing _directly_ (no spooler, no server) to an HP 4MV printer
from a Mac. I had to select "prefer TrueType" font and so on in the
printing configuration dialog box for it to print everything ok. So,
I assume you can deal with this problem with your Mac's configuration.

Guillaume Menguy wrote:
> Hi, I have a linux box running redhat6.1 + pre-asun2.1.4-36 and
> samba.When I try to print from a PC, the output is okay.When I print
> from a Mac, the accentuated characters are replaced by spaces.When on
> a mac I chose "always download fonts to the printer", it sometimes
> work, sometimes not. I think it depends on the fonts installed on the
> mac.And when the macs print throught an NT server, it always
> rocks.Perhaps the NT server automatically send the fonts to the
> printer ? How can I force the Linux Box to act the same way?Any Idea ?
> Thanks. G. Menguy
